Astronomy Day – Fernbank – 2013-04-20

20 April, 2013 (23:02) | Events, Outreach | By: tramakers

We had a great day of clear skies for National Astronomy Day at the Fernbank Science Center! Visitors were able to see the star closest to our planet (a.k.a. the Sun) through a total of 7 white light and hydrogen alpha telescopes. Parents and children alike were amazed at what they were able to see, particularly through the hydrogen alpha telescopes. One of our young visitors won a Celestron Astromaster telescope and plans to join us at Charlie Elliott to learn how to use it. The observatory was also open and visitors were able to see Jupiter in the middle of the day. A few club members noticed the “little” 14 inch Schmidt Cassegrain riding piggy back on the main telescope.

Stars over Panola Mountain 2013-04-06

6 April, 2013 (23:38) | Events, Outreach | By: tramakers

This was our evening program for the vistors of Panola mountain. The viewing site at the base of the mountain was very restricted and we were standing on the dam of a pond looking at the night sky. some very interested people stayed with us until the end of the event and despite the cloud coverage and linited view, they observed Jupiter and its moons, (trough the tree branches), M42 and finally Saturn as it rose above the tree tops.
